Phoenix Contact 1822833 Equivalent & Substitute Parts

Part Overview

The Phoenix Contact 1822833 is a 10-position wire-to-board terminal block with horizontal mating orientation and 4.6mm pitch, designed for through-hole PCB mounting. This component operates at 10A and 300V, accommodating wire gauges from 16-24 AWG with screwless push-in spring termination. The part is active in production status and ROHS3 compliant, making it suitable for industrial control, automation, and power distribution applications where reliable wire-to-board connections are required. Substitute Part Grouping Explanation

Substitution eligibility for the Phoenix Contact 1822833 is determined by strict equivalence across the following critical parameters: 10-position configuration, 4.6mm pitch spacing, horizontal board-mounted orientation, through-hole installation method, 10A current capacity, 300V voltage rating, and 16-24 AWG wire gauge compatibility. The WAGO 2086-1210 qualifies as a direct substitute because it matches all mandatory electrical and mechanical specifications. Both parts employ screwless termination mechanisms (push-in spring versus push-button clamp), maintain identical pitch and position count, support the same wire gauge range, and deliver equivalent electrical performance. Packaging differences (bulk versus tray) and housing material variations (LCP versus glass-filled PPA) do not affect functional interchangeability in circuit applications. Both parts maintain ROHS3 compliance and unlimited moisture sensitivity ratings.

Engineering Selection Recommendations

Both the Phoenix Contact 1822833 and WAGO 2086-1210 are active production components with ROHS3 compliance and unlimited moisture sensitivity ratings, qualifying them for equivalent use in applications requiring 10-position, 4.6mm-pitch terminal blocks. Selection between these parts should be based on availability, packaging requirements (bulk versus tray), and termination mechanism preference (leg spring push-in versus push-button clamp actuation). The WAGO 2086-1210 provides an operating temperature range of -60°C to 105°C, whereas the Phoenix Contact 1822833 does not specify operating temperature limits in the provided data. For applications with defined temperature requirements, this specification should be verified against system operating conditions. Both parts maintain identical electrical ratings and wire gauge compatibility, ensuring functional interchangeability in standard wire-to-board connection applications.
